Sunset over Kreuzberg

- SCAM28 - Wednesday, March 14th, 2007 : goo

Browsing articles by SCAM28 - [previous] :: [next]

image 18891

Here's a sunset in Kreuzberg, Berlin...on the left there's a main road and the high-rise rail subway...I love this road, because it's surrounded by three busy roads and no one drives on it. All the roads are so busy so that there is no advantage in taking this road...it leads right by a church and has an old single brick road style....it's just nice....

image 18892

This is right in front of the train station which you can see pretty much in the middle of the picture above....
I like the building being build on the left side of this one, with the glas dome...
